Output 99e3e8cd18086a60d07208ab022e5176022e771dc7e251f234706b26e8d00eb2:1

value
399955571
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3bd2e292c50e748b0f2cf3b4e188ef461830fac OP_EQUAL
address
3Lzb8Vt3ZvbnSYwNLTxANudaRyepyQ7MdB
transaction
99e3e8cd18086a60d07208ab022e5176022e771dc7e251f234706b26e8d00eb2
spent
true